Output d747807559a10f87f3b6d1ce3ed920a41609579352c032accc62bdf9f0b1dae8:94

value
1310715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a07acb0747d9314458045350c2400727459ad7 OP_EQUAL
address
38x3Z29hfGAmtAoz7RnVTMbYbBYHTAbc6C
transaction
d747807559a10f87f3b6d1ce3ed920a41609579352c032accc62bdf9f0b1dae8
confirmations
135746
spent
true